Community Development Overview

The Department of Community Development administers the planning, zoning, economic development, building permit and inspection, health, and nonresidential code enforcement activities for the Village. The Department carries out these activities in two divisions: (1) Planning and Economic Development; and (2) Building and Inspectional Services.

Planning and Economic Development

The Planning and Economic Development Division encourages economic growth by attracting new businesses and developments to the Village, as well as retaining and expanding existing businesses and developments.  You can read more about Economic Development in that section of our website.  Click here to go to the Economic Development Overview.

Long-Range Planning
(Comprehensive Plan and Village Center)

The Planning and Economic Development Division is also responsible for administering and implementing the long-range land use planning goals for the Village of Hanover Park.  Key reference information is provided via the Village's Comprehensive Plan, which was approved in August, 1998.   In addition to the Comprehensive Plan, the Village approved the Village Center Tax Increment Finance (TIF) District Plan in May, 2001.

Building and Inspectional Services

The Inspectional Services Division protects public health, safety, and welfare by performing periodic health and property maintenance inspections, and inspections of all nonresidential buildings. The Division also performs construction inspections on all new buildings and improvements to assure compliance with building codes. Finally, the Division is responsible for ensuring a safe and sanitary environment for food service and sales and nonresidential properties to enforce the property maintenance and other health-related codes of the Village. Other specific division responsibilities include:

  • Review of all proposed construction in the Village to ensure compliance with applicable construction regulations.

  • Issuing permits for construction and other miscellaneous improvements, including signs.

  • Periodic inspections of all food service and sales and medical facilities to ensure compliance with health regulations.

  • Periodic inspections of all nonresidential properties to ensure compliance with property maintenance regulations.

  • Providing education and technical assistance to residents, businesses, contractors, and other interested parties. This includes training and classes for home improvements and remodeling, electrical repair, and food service and safety.
